Data from Yale Polling found that young people are swaying significantly to the right, with voters aged 18 to 21 leaning Republican by 11.7 points when looking at their prospective voting in the 2026 midterms, according to Newsweek. While young people have traditionally voted Democrat for generations, Gen Z may be making history in their ideologies. Breaking Down The Data Vice President J.D. Vance was ranked as the most popular personality amongst Republicans with a +65 rating overall, +54 among Republican voters under the age of 30. A majority (53%) said they would support Vance if he ran in the 2028 GOP primary, while only 27.5% of Democrats said they’d vote for former Vice President Kamala Harris despite having a generally good favorability rating. Trump is also very popular among young people, with a 52.7% rating among 18 to 29-year-olds. Bloomberg’s David M.
